Brazing Alloys The Wesgo® Metals Division manufactures and supplies precious and non-precious high-purity, low vapor pressure brazing alloys in various forms. Many readily available items are offered. Simply provide the alloy/material type and dimensions as listed below and Wesgo® Metals will provide you with the best materials available. 
  
Configuration  Required Dimensions*  Unit of Measure
Disc OD, Thickness Each
Wire Segments  Length, Diameter  Each
Sheet  Width, Thickness  Length or Weight
Shims Length, Width, Thickness Each
Ring  OD, Wire Diameter Gap  Each
Washers   OD, ID, Thickness Each
Wire  Diameter  Length or Weight
Powder  Mesh Size  Weight
Paste  Mesh Size, Binder Type  Weight

*Standard tolerances apply for individual dimensions.
For specially designed preforms and complex configurations Wesgo® Metals can work with your drawings to meet your specific needs.

Brazing Alloys
Active Brazing Alloys (ABATM) are a recent advancement in the continuing quest to expand the understanding and application of materials science. ABATM alloys provide a breakthrough single-step approach for joining ceramics to metals by eliminating the need for prior metallization of the ceramic surface. A typical use is to produce strong hermetic joints for numerous vacuum brazing applications.
 
Melt-Spun Foil Melt-Spun Foil is made by rapid solidification, a process that enables the manufacture of amorphous metals which are unable to be manufactured by conventional cold or hot rolling techniques. Melt-Spun Foil and preforms are commonly used to braze heat exchanger assemblies, to assemble and repair compressor vanes, stators, and hush kits for aero engines, and to produce cutting surfaces by brazing diamond compounds to tungsten carbide.
 
Nicuman® Alloys such as Nicuman®-23 and Nicuman®-37 are manufactured in foil, wire, and preforms. These alloys possess high shear strength, making them suitable for brazing tool bits to tungsten-carbide mining and oil-drilling tools. Other applications include automotive and vacuum devices.
 
Pre-Sintered
Preforms (PSP
TM)
Wesgo-PSPTM products are a sintered blend of brazing and superalloy powders available in various shapes and compositions. Many OEMs and repair facilities depend on Wesgo-PSPTM to rebuild the contours of turbine blades and vanes. Wesgo-PSPTM provides selective buildup of the part contour, saves bench time, enhances cost-effectiveness, and avoids the distortion associated with welding.
 
Stopyt® The Stopyt® family of products consists of inert, rare earth compositions in liquid and paste form. Stopyt® products are used as a barrier to the flow of molten metal alloys, thereby protecting holes and non-braze areas from coverage and clogging. It finds many applications in the general process, aero-engine, and vacuum device industries, as well as lubricant applications in super-plastic forming and other processes.
